> Currently, the {{BlobLibraryCacheManager}} is responsible for keeping 
> reference counts (amongst others) for files stored in the {{BlobServer}}. 
> Additionally it has a periodic timer task which deletes files from the 
> {{BlobServer}} if the reference count is {{0}}.
> The {{BlobServer}} is responsible for storing files locally (on the 
> {{JobManager}}). Moreover, it has a {{BlobStore}} reference which it uses to 
> store files persistently for HA.
> I think it is a wrong separation of concerns that the 
> {{BlobLibraryCacheManager}} is responsible for reference counting. Instead I 
> would propose to move this functionality to the {{BlobServer}} and 
> {{BlobCache}}, respectively. That way, the {{BlobLibraryCacheManager}} is 
> only responsible for keeping track of blobs relevant for a given job and its 
> user code class loader.
> Additionally, we could think about merging the {{BlobServer}}/{{BlobCache}} 
> and the {{BlobStore}} functionality by having a 
> {{FileSystemBlobServer}}/{{FileSystemBlobCache}} which will be configured in 
> the HA case with a DFS path.
